To start, it is vital to understand what bacterial contaminants are and how they can infiltrate your water supply. Bacteria are microscopic organisms that can enter water systems through natural sources like rivers and lakes or due to human activities such as agriculture and wastewater discharge. Among the most common types are Escherichia coli (E. coli), Salmonella, and Campylobacter, all of which can cause illnesses like gastroenteritis, diarrhea, and more severe conditions if left unchecked.

The first step in ensuring your water is free from harmful bacteria is testing. Regular water testing is an invaluable tool for detecting the presence of bacterial contaminants. Home testing kits are available, but for a thorough analysis, professional testing services are recommended. Once you have confirmed the presence of bacterial contaminants, treating your water becomes the next critical step. There are several effective methods to ensure your water is safe for consumption. One such method is chlorination, which involves adding chlorine to water to kill bacteria. This method is widely used for its efficiency and affordability. However, it requires careful handling and monitoring, making professional assistance advisable.

Ultraviolet (UV) purification is another highly effective method for eliminating bacteria from your water supply. This treatment uses UV light to damage the DNA of bacteria, rendering them harmless. Unlike chemical treatments, UV purification leaves no residue or taste, maintaining the natural quality of your water. For homeowners seeking a chemical-free solution, filtration systems are an excellent choice. Advanced filtration systems, such as reverse osmosis, can effectively remove bacteria and other contaminants by forcing water through a semi-permeable membrane. This process not only purifies water but also improves its taste and clarity.

Prevention is just as important as treatment when it comes to safeguarding your family's water supply. Regular maintenance of water systems and staying informed about potential sources of contamination in your area are essential practices. Educating your family about water safety ensures everyone is aware of basic precautions, such as boiling water during advisories or using filtered water for drinking and cooking.
